Definitions:

Observational Learning

A learning process that occurs through observing the behavior of others and the outcomes of those behaviors.

Operant Conditioning

A method of learning that employs rewards and punishments for behavior, which was developed by B.F. Skinner.

Learned Helplessness

A condition in which a person suffers from a sense of powerlessness, arising from a traumatic event or persistent failure to succeed, theorized to lead to depression and other mental illnesses.

Psychopathology

The scientific study of mental disorders, including their symptoms, etiology (causes), and treatment.
